00问答网
所有问题
当前搜索:
matlab怎么给数组往后续
matlab中怎样
批量提取文件中数据并赋值给新
数组
,并另外存储新生成的数...
答:
B(m,:)=A(i,:)取A的第i行存放在B的第m行中 但是如果不连续 ,而是离散的一些数据就必须知道它的下标了 B(m,n)=A(i,j)讲A的第i行,第j列存放在B(m,n)位置上。
matlab中
把一维
数组
逆序排列的方式有哪些?
答:
1、双击打开
matlab
应用程序。2、在matlab界面中的“命令行窗口”中输入命令。3、根据红色区域位置,在“命令行窗口”输入“a=[1,2,3,4,5]”。4、通过函数fliplr求矩阵逆序排列,在“命令行窗口”输入“b=fliplr(a)”,按下回车键。可求得矩阵逆序排列b=[5,4,3,2,1]。
matlab如何
表述
数组
的递推?
答:
如果你的a[i]是用来表示第i个矩阵,a[i-1]是用来表示第二个矩阵的话,那你要建一个3维的矩阵,这样表示是没错的a(:,:,i)表示第i个矩阵,a(:,:,i+1)表示第i+1个矩阵,a(:,:,i)=a(:,:,i-1)+1;这样就行了。你
数组
递推,肯定是有很多2维的数组,所以用个3维的数组才能表示递...
matlab如何对数组
元素进行排列索引?
答:
2、方法:限制索引取值范围0到(数组长度-1),或者增加数组的长度
。arr[0]=1;arr[1]=2;此数组长度为2,下标最大为1(数组下标从0开始);如果下标超出0-1这个范围就会出现索引超出界限问题。3、你可以使用MATLAB的内置函数size()来确定你的表格的大小,然后确保你的索引在这个范围内。如果你的...
matlab 如何
把一个
数组
倒过来?
答:
用fliplr,如\x0d\x0ax=[1 2 3 4 5];\x0d\x0afliplr(x)\x0d\x0a\x0d\x0aans =\x0d\x0a\x0d\x0a 5 4 3 2 1
如何用matlab
编程从
数组
的第一列到最后一列依次取出每两列?
答:
c=A(:,[i:i+n-1]);%每次循环赋值给c ind=size(1:n:size(A,2),2)-floor((size(A,2)-i)/n);推导文件名下标与循环变量的关系 eval(['B',num2str(ind),'=c',';']);%产生多个B
数组
,B1,B2.。。。end 这是通用程序,你可以输入任意A,设定取几列数,当最终不够设定列数时将...
matlab中
,
如何
把一个一维长度为600的
数组
赋值给另一个25×600矩阵的任...
答:
设a
为
一维长度为600的向量,b为一个25×600矩阵,将a赋值给b矩阵的第i行;b(i,:)=a;即可。
如何
将
matlab数组
循环赋值给另外一组数组
答:
function for_rnd()m=[1200,700,650,1300,600,630];n=[100,50,50,80,100,80];产生均值,方差分别
为
m(i),n(i)的随机数200个 d=cell(1,6);%用单元
数组
for i=1:6 r=normrnd(m(i),n(i),1,200);d{i}=r;end d{1}就是第一个1X200 的随机数,可以用d{1}(1)引用第一个...
matlab中如何对数组
进行下标和索引?
答:
三种方法。1、下标法(subscripts)A(ii,jj):其中ii和jj可以是一维向量、标量、“:”号或者“end”比如:A(2:3,3:-1:1)表示引用
数组
中的2~3行,3~1列对应的元素 A(:,end)表示引用最后一列元素,“:”表示所有列或行,“end”表示最后一列或列,“end-n”表示倒数第n行或列 A(1,end-...
用MATLAB
编写一个函数输入
数组
6 个元素,最大的与第一个元素交换,最小的...
答:
function y = change(x)y = x;a = x(1);b = x(end);[c,d] = max(x);[e,f] = min(x);y(1) = c;y(end) = e y(d) = a;y(f) = b;end
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
matlab数组添加到数组末尾
matlab追加数组
matlab保存数组
matlab给数组赋相同值
matlab计算结果存入数组
matlab随机打乱数组顺序
matlab怎么给数组扩容
matlab求数组的中位数
matlab数组逆序排列